RELEASE CHECKLIST — DeployBot (Pinelock). Confirm bot posts status to the release channel within 30s of rollout start. Verify it reports stage, canary health, and abort commands work from the on-call account only. If the bot goes silent, restart the Pinelock relay and re-check webhook delivery. Do not ship until the bot echoes green on all three regions. When it confirms, paste the acknowledgment into the checklist. The build token it should echo appears below.

pipeline stamp: htk3_a71

Off-site run, item 4: Collect the Varnholt HSM unit from the Delmere secure store, verify the tamper seal is intact and matches the manifest, and keep the case in sight at all times during transit to the Ashbrook data centre. Before departure, brief the driver personally and relay the following hand-over instruction word for word:

dispatch memo: the eliok quenok courier leaves the sorael aldath belion tammir casix gileth queniel jorath ledger at gate 9299 under passcode 897989

**Q: When can deliveries come through the loading dock?**

The Kestrel Row loading dock accepts deliveries Monday to Friday, 07:30–16:00 only. Couriers arriving outside these hours must use the main entrance and wait for a facilities escort — please never wave them through yourself. As a new starter, you may be asked to sign for small parcels at the dock window; bring your induction paperwork the first time. The dock's inner door requires the staff entry code shown below.

turnstile pass: bdg-NG-3